In honor of Mental Health Awareness Month, Stigma Free Somerset County invites you to participate in our first annual conference.
Mental Health Matters
The purpose of the conference is to build a sustainable coalition of consumers, family members, providers and other stakeholders that will promote mental wellness and recovery for individuals and communities. Through a series of dedicated workshops highlighting prevention, early intervention, treatment and recovery resources delivered by coalition partners.
It is a frequently reported fact that 1 in 4 Americans are affected by mental illness and substance use disorders. When the dust settles and statistics catch up to the everyday reality of post-pandemic life, we can be fairly certain the percentage will increase. There will be a new “normal” for providers of mental health and addiction services. We are providing education to the community to bridge the resource gap and support residents’ health and wellness. Somerset County is fortunate to have a well established network of collaborative providers fighting mental health stigma.
